The Art And Science Of Etching Metal

etching metal is a fascinating process that has been used for centuries to create intricate designs and patterns on various metals. It involves using a chemical solution to remove some of the metal’s surface layers, leaving behind a permanent design etched into the metal. This technique is commonly used in jewelry making, printmaking, and industrial applications, and can produce stunning results when done correctly.

The process of etching metal begins with preparing the metal surface for etching. The metal is cleaned thoroughly to remove any dirt, grease, or oxidation that may interfere with the etching process. A resist material, such as wax or asphaltum, is then applied to the metal surface to protect areas that are not meant to be etched. The resist material can be applied using a variety of methods, including brushing, spraying, or stenciling.

Once the resist material is in place, the metal is ready for the etching process. The metal is submerged in a chemical solution, known as an etchant, that is capable of dissolving the metal’s surface layers. Common etchants used for metal etching include ferric chloride, nitric acid, and hydrochloric acid. The metal is left in the etchant for a specific amount of time, depending on the desired depth of the etching.

As the metal is etched, the resist material protects the areas that are not meant to be etched, creating a sharp contrast between the etched and unetched sections. The etching process can be controlled by monitoring factors such as temperature, agitation, and etchant concentration. By adjusting these variables, the artist can achieve different effects, such as varying depths of etching and fine details in the design.

Once the etching is complete, the metal is removed from the etchant and the resist material is removed to reveal the finished design. The metal may be further treated to enhance the contrast of the etched design, such as by applying a patina or polishing the metal.
